Analysis
In 2021, electricity production from renewable sources, excluding in Bahrain stood at 8.54 kWh per person. That is the highest value across all 32 years on record.
That represents a change of up 12.2% on the previous year and up 750.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, electricity production from renewable sources, excluding in Bahrain peaked at 8.54 kWh per person in 2021 and was at its lowest, 0 kWh per person, in 1990.
That places Bahrain 154th out of 209 countries with data for 2021,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ric (kWh) divided by Population, total, mat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ric (kWh) ÷ Population, total
Computed from
-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ric IEA Energy Statistics Data Browser, International Energy Agency (IEA)
- Population, total World Population Prospects, United Nations (UN)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
